Altronix MAXIMAL37E Expandable Power Supply/Charger
Overview
The Altronix MAXIMAL37E is a dual-output expandable power supply and charger designed for security and access control system installations requiring flexible voltage and current distribution. This unit delivers two independent power supplies within a single BC800 enclosure: one 12/24VDC output rated at 6A, and one dedicated 24VDC output rated at 10A. The expandable architecture supports system growth without requiring complete unit replacement, making it ideal for distributed access control, video surveillance infrastructure, and networked security applications where modular power delivery is essential.
Key Features
- Dual Independent Outputs: 1 × 12/24VDC @ 6A and 1 × 24VDC @ 10A for flexible voltage configuration
- Total Current Capacity: 16A aggregate power delivery across both supplies
- 115VAC Input: Standard single-phase AC mains connection
- BC800 Metal Enclosure: Compact, DIN-rail mountable form factor suitable for electrical rooms and equipment racks
- Expandable Design: Modular architecture supports future capacity additions without full system replacement
- Battery Backup Integration: Charger function enables auxiliary battery backup for critical circuits
- Isolated Outputs: Separate power supplies allow independent load management and fault isolation
- Industrial-Grade Construction: Metal enclosure with integrated thermal protection for continuous operation
Integration & Compatibility
The MAXIMAL37E integrates into access control panels, video management systems, and intercom infrastructure requiring redundant or segregated power circuits. The dual-voltage capability accommodates both 12V and 24V field devices without requiring separate conversion modules. The charger output enables trickle-charging of auxiliary backup batteries, providing holdover power during mains failures. The BC800 enclosure footprint matches standard electrical cabinet layouts, simplifying integration into existing installations. Independent outputs prevent voltage sag from high-current loads on one circuit from affecting sensitive control circuits on the other, critical for systems combining high-draw switching power with low-current microprocessor circuits.
Specification Summary
Input: 115VAC, single-phase. Output Configuration: Two independent supplies — 12/24VDC @ 6A (selectable) and 24VDC @ 10A. Enclosure: BC800 metal chassis. The modular expandable design allows integration of additional power cards within the BC800 frame, accommodating larger installations or future system expansion. The MAXIMAL37E serves as the foundation power stage for multi-stage security infrastructure deployments.

The Altronix MAXIMAL37E addresses a common field requirement: powering access control and video infrastructure from a single enclosure without voltage conflict or current starvation. During a recent multi-door access system retrofit, we specified the MAXIMAL37E because the 12/24V selectable output accommodated legacy 12V magnetic locks alongside new 24V electronic strikes—eliminating the need for separate supplies and simplifying cabinet wiring.
Technical Highlights:
- Dual-Output Isolation: The separate 6A and 10A supplies prevent nuisance brownouts when door hardware draws peak current; video and access control remain stable
- Battery Charger Function: Built-in charger output allows auxiliary battery integration for graceful power-loss handoff without additional modules
- Expandable Frame: The BC800 form factor accepts additional power cards, scaling capacity from 16A to 30A+ without cabinet redesign
Deployment Considerations:
- Verify legacy 12V device voltage tolerance before selecting the selectable output; some devices require fixed 24V supply
- Size backup batteries based on aggregate load current; the charger output should match your auxiliary battery amp-hour rating
- Plan cable routing to keep AC mains lines separated from low-voltage outputs to minimize conducted noise on access control circuits
The MAXIMAL37E is a practical choice for integrators standardizing on modular power architecture. Its dual outputs and expandable design reduce parts inventory and deployment complexity, while the charger function enables battery-backed critical circuits without external UPS hardware.
